Hancher Stars in Scots’ 2-1 Win Over Presidents

WOOSTER, Ohio – Junior midfielder Lauren Hancher scored one goal and assisted on another, leading The College of Wooster past Washington & Jefferson College 2-1 in a non-conference women's soccer match-up late Wednesday afternoon at Carl Dale Field.

Hancher took the first shot of the game during the fourth minute, and in the ninth, she notched an assist on the opening score. She gained possession in Washington & Jefferson's (1-4) defensive half, sent a short pass left to Lily Mohre, whose shot from about 20 yards out hit the crossbar and deflected downward into the goal. It was Mohre's third goal this season.

Wooster (5-2) maintained the 1-0 lead throughout the remainder of the first half, with Elizabeth Clark recording three saves in goal.

Clark's best stop of the game came moments into the second half, as she came sliding out to turn away a Tatiana Ruzzini run into the box.

Later, Hancher went on the offensive, firing off four shots in about a nine-minute stretch. She was denied on one by the Presidents' outstretched 'keeper, Morgan Kinyon, who dove to her left. Shortly after, Hancher dribbled up field, kept possession while being challenged by multiple defenders, and buried a shot into the lower right for a 2-0 cushion in the 66th minute.

Washington & Jefferson answered with a Ruzzini goal, assisted by Megan Ochsenreiter, in the 69th minute.

While it was a one-goal game the rest of the way, the Presidents never threatened to put in the equalizer as the defensive line, consisting of Brenna Coolbaugh, Rachael Davis, Carly Joliat, and Liz Kantra, held the visitors without a shot the final 20 minutes.

The Fighting Scots will take on another western Pennsylvania school this Saturday afternoon, traveling to Geneva College (1-4).
